Setting Traps

Sticky traps around tree trunks can capture nymphs as they climb. However, it’s important to cover the sticky area with mesh to prevent accidentally trapping birds and other wildlife. This simple method can significantly reduce lanternfly numbers in your yard.
When to Call Professionals

If your yard is heavily infested, it might be best to call in pest control professionals. They can use more potent solutions, like systemic insecticides, that are safe for your plants but deadly for the Spotted Lanternfly. Additionally, always report sightings to local authorities to help track and manage the spread of these pests.
